As of now, the actor is all set for the theatrical release of Baaghi 4, the darkest film of the Baaghi franchise.

However, in the last few years, he witnessed a career slump because of a series of consecutive box office failures, including Ganpath, Heropanti 2, and Bade Mitan Chote Miyan. In a recent interview, Tiger recalled over the upcoming installment, his different character, struggling through the dark period of his career, and much more.

He also opened up about his thoughts and the moment and said, “Feeling restless, happy, excited, blessed, and grateful that the audiences are going to see a very different side of him in next release Baaghi 4 for which he is much looking forward to their response. The last few years have definitely not been easy, but it’s been such a learning curve. He thinks it’s because of it, he sort of emerged as a better artist.

The actor further went on to add that he has imparted the lessons of his tough phase into his upcoming movie, Baaghi 4. He has put all those learnings into Baaghi 4 and pins hopes that the audience will accept him. As he mentioned earlier really predicts the fate of a film.

When asked about what went possibly wrong with his last release Bade Miyan Chote Miyan, with Akshay Kumar, he shared, that with Bade Miyan Chote Miyan, to be honest he thought it had everything going for it. Unfortunately, it didn’t quite connect with audiences. But he really enjoyed the entire process of shooting the film and forever grateful to (producers) Vashu Bhagnani ji and Jackky Bhagnani ji.”
Tiger continued, “To director Ali Abbas Zafar one of his most favourite directors and of course, his co-actor and childhood hero, Akshay Kumar. They had a blast shooting the film, and he wouldn’t change anything if he(Tiger) had to do the film again.
The actor has always maintained his ‘action hero’s image since his very first release. However, Baaghi 4’s trailer gave a glimpse of his violent, gruesome, and bloodshedding character. “I do believe action is definitely my forte. I’m very grateful that people have accepted me as an action hero in the industry. It’s tough to constantly reinvent myself in the genre, though. But with Baaghi 4, I’m quite confident this is a very different aspect, perspective, and language of action that I’ve attempted,” he explained.

He added, “I’m hoping audiences enjoy it. This is a very different version of me and, I’d say, a sub-genre within the action genre. I’m hoping that just as audiences accepted me in War when I did something different, they’ll accept him the same way in this avatar.”
A Harsha’s directorial, Baaghi 4 also features Harnaaz Sandhu, Sonam Bajwa, and Sanjay Dutt. The film hits the theatres on September 5.
